Output 508961bc2b4136c69dff0861df438d6e618c79c640ff9e567f064dd57b400352:14

value
32586
script pubkey
OP_0 OP_PUSHBYTES_20 dfb388b6749e3e781ce93e088f3b87717e37e3e8
address
bc1qm7ec3dn5ncl8s88f8cyg7wu8w9lr0clg47xqk3
transaction
508961bc2b4136c69dff0861df438d6e618c79c640ff9e567f064dd57b400352
spent
true